What do hermit crab breath through?

Hermit crabs breathe through modified gills, which means that they CAN drown in water, they need to keep their gills moist. between 70 - 80 % humidity. and temp between 70 - 80 F temp.

Is smoke good around hermit crabs?

No. Hermit crabs have modified gills, meaning that they need 70-80% humidity in order to breath. However hermit crabs cannot breath under water; they will drown. It is important to have the humidity between 70-80% so the hermit crab can properly breath. Smoke is toxic to hermit crabs and will eventually kill them.

Can a whelk eat a hermit crab?

Yes, a whelk can eat a hermit crab. Whelks are carnivorous marine snails that prey on various invertebrates, including crustaceans like hermit crabs. They use their specialized radula to drill through the hard shell of the hermit crab to access its soft body. However, the likelihood of this occurring depends on the size and species of both the whelk and the hermit crab.
